Southeast Texas provides a spectrum of compassionate end-of-life care options for citizens and their support systems.
From hospice services to palliative care, facilities in the region are dedicated to maximizing the quality of life for those facing a limiting illness.
Professionals work tirelessly to alleviate pain and distress, while providing spiritual support to both patients and their families.
A key aspect of compassionate end-of-life care is clear communication, allowing patients to share their wishes and ensuring that their preferences are respected throughout the process.
Southeast Texas embraces a holistic approach to end-of-life care, recognizing the social well-being of the individual as essential. Agencies within the community offer a range of programs to assist families through this challenging time.
Supporting Your Loved Ones Through Their Final Chapters
When facing a terminal illness, finding comfort and support can be paramount. Hospice services provide a caring and comforting approach to managing the physical, emotional, and spiritual needs of individuals in their final stages of life, as well as their families.
- Regional hospice programs offer a range of services, including medical care, pain management, counseling, and spiritual support, all designed to enhance quality of life during this challenging time.
- Loved ones can benefit from the expertise of a dedicated team of healthcare professionals who provide individualized care approaches.
- Hospice services also offer valuable tools for families, helping them navigate the emotional and practical aspects of end-of-life care.
Remember that hospice is not just about medical care but also about providing a loving environment where individuals can live their remaining days with dignity and peace.

Advanced Palliative Care for Every Need
Palliative care is no longer a singular approach reserved for the final stages of life. It has evolved into a holistic field website that addresses the individualized needs of patients at every stage of their illness. Whether you are navigating a chronic disorder, recovering from surgery, or merely seeking to optimize your quality of life, there is a tailored palliative care option designed for you.
- Compassionate teams of doctors, nurses, and other healthcare professionals work together to alleviate your symptoms with kindness.
- Beyond physical comfort, palliative care also strengthens your emotional, social, and spiritual well-being.
- It provides a safety net of assistance for you and your caretakers during tumultuous times.
